
Fossil fuels are a major source of energy worldwide, accounting for nearly 60% of electricity generation. However, they are extremely harmful to the planet and human health, driving climate change and causing approximately 8 million deaths in 2018. As a result, there is a growing movement to reduce our reliance on fossil fuels and transition to renewable alternatives. These alternatives include solar, wind, hydro, nuclear, biomass, biofuel, and geothermal energy. They offer several advantages over fossil fuels, such as being cleaner, more accessible, affordable, sustainable, and reliable. Additionally, they emit little to no greenhouse gases or air pollutants, helping to address climate change and air pollution. Renewable energy sources are also becoming increasingly affordable and efficient, with over 90% of new renewable projects cheaper than fossil fuel alternatives. This makes them an attractive option for low- and middle-income countries, driving inclusive economic growth and new jobs. While the transition to renewables will require significant investment, it is necessary to ensure a healthy and livable planet for future generations.

Renewable energy sources are abundant, accessible, and affordable. They are available in all countries, and their potential is yet to be fully realized. Renewable energy sources include solar, wind, tidal, biofuel, hydroelectric, and geothermal power, as well as non-renewable nuclear power.
The prices of renewable energy technologies are dropping rapidly, making them an increasingly attractive alternative to fossil fuels. Over 90% of new renewable projects are now cheaper than fossil fuel alternatives. Solar power is now 41% cheaper than fossil fuels, and offshore wind is 53% cheaper. As a result, many countries are already operating on significant renewable energy sources, and the demand for renewable energy is growing, particularly in low- and middle-income countries.
The accessibility and affordability of renewable energy sources are further enhanced by their ability to provide a way out of import dependency. Renewable energy sources can be harnessed locally, allowing countries to diversify their economies and protect themselves from the unpredictable price swings of fossil fuels. This is particularly important as about 80% of the global population lives in countries that are net importers of fossil fuels, making them vulnerable to geopolitical shocks and crises.
The affordability of renewable energy sources is also driven by their potential to create new jobs and drive inclusive economic growth. The renewable energy sector already employs almost 35 million people worldwide, and for every dollar invested, renewable energy creates three times as many jobs as the fossil fuel industry. By 2040, for example, it is estimated that Africa could generate 10 times more electricity than it needs, entirely from renewable sources.

Fossil fuels have been the primary energy source for much of human history, but they are finite resources that contribute to global warming and climate change. Renewable energy sources, such as solar, wind, and hydroelectric power, are increasingly being adopted as alternatives.
One significant advantage of renewable energy is that it reduces a country's import dependency. Fossil fuels are often imported, with about 80% of the global population living in countries that are net importers of fossil fuels. This reliance on imports leaves countries vulnerable to geopolitical shocks and crises. In contrast, renewable energy sources are available in all countries and can be harnessed locally, reducing the need for international trade.
The diversification of energy sources also protects countries from unpredictable fossil fuel price swings. Fossil fuel prices can be volatile due to various factors, including supply and demand, geopolitical events, and extraction costs. Renewable energy sources, on the other hand, often have stable prices that are becoming increasingly competitive with fossil fuels. Over 90% of new renewable energy projects are now cheaper than fossil fuel alternatives, with solar and offshore wind being 41% and 53% cheaper, respectively.
By investing in renewable energy sources, countries can reduce their dependency on fossil fuel imports and protect themselves from unpredictable price fluctuations. This not only strengthens their energy security but also drives inclusive economic growth and new job opportunities. The advantages of using alternatives to fossil fuels are numerous. Renewable energy sources such as solar, wind, and hydropower emit little to no greenhouse gases, are readily available, and are often cheaper than coal, oil, or gas. They are also inexhaustible, with sources like sunlight and wind constantly replenished by nature.
Transitioning to renewable energy can reduce pollution and climate impacts, saving the world trillions of dollars annually. It can also decrease dependence on energy imports, protecting countries from unpredictable fossil fuel price swings. This promotes economic growth, new jobs, and poverty alleviation.
Indeed, renewable energy creates three times as many jobs as the fossil fuel industry for every dollar invested. While about 5 million jobs in fossil fuel production could be lost by 2030, an estimated 14 million new jobs are expected to be created in clean energy, resulting in a net gain of 9 million jobs. This increase in employment opportunities is also seen in other sectors, such as healthcare, due to policies that reroute revenue to taxpayers.
Furthermore, renewable energy jobs often offer higher wages and better benefits than the national average and the fossil fuel industry. For example, median wages for clean energy careers are 25% higher than the national median and are more likely to include health and retirement benefits.

Renewable energy sources are available in all countries, and their potential is yet to be fully harnessed. The sun shines and the wind blows everywhere, and renewable energy sources are abundant, replenished by nature, and emit little to no greenhouse gases or air pollutants.
Solar and wind energy are abundantly available and have been growing quickly in many countries across the world. In 2022, Germany set a target of 80% renewable power by 2030 and close to 100% by 2035. Renewables accounted for 46.9% of German power consumption in 2022, a 4.9% increase from 2021. In the same year, Uruguay generated 91% of its electricity from renewable sources, up from a third of energy generation in the early 2000s. In 2012, Sweden reached its target of 50% renewable energy eight years ahead of schedule and is on track to reach its 2040 goal of 100% fossil-free renewable electricity production.
Prices for renewable energy technologies are dropping rapidly, making them more attractive worldwide, especially in low- and middle-income countries where most of the future demand for new electricity will arise. By 2040, Africa could generate 10 times more electricity than it needs, entirely from renewables.
Renewable energy sources are also more stable in price and do not produce polluting waste. In 2020, renewable energy represented 19.1% of gross final energy consumption, a figure that is expected to double by 2030.

Fossil fuels are energy sources that have been present in the Earth's subsoil for millions of years. They are created through the accumulation and decomposition of organic matter. Fossil fuels include coal, natural gas, and oil, and they are currently the majority energy sources worldwide, representing 81% of primary energy consumption.
Renewable alternatives to fossil fuels include solar, wind, hydro, nuclear, biomass/biofuel, and geothermal power. Solar energy uses photovoltaic (PV) panels to convert sunlight into electricity, while wind energy uses turbines to convert wind power into electricity. Hydro or hydroelectric power uses the energy in moving water to generate electricity.
